Montgomery County Community College has received funding through generous donations to assist students experiencing financial hardships.

Apply for funding



Who is eligible to apply?
  • Any degree or certificate MCCC student is eligible to apply.
    • Non-degree, guest students, and students who have graduated or withdrawn are not eligible for general emergency grant funding.
    • New students must have started attending courses at the College to be considered for emergency grants.
What are the criteria to qualify?

To qualify for general emergency grant funding, at a minimum, you must:

  • Be enrolled and attending classes in the current term
  • Demonstrate a financial hardship.
  • Each funding source has different criteria, meaning that the application will be matched with a fund for which the student qualifies and subject to availability of funding.
How do I apply?

You can apply online by completing the Emergency Assistance request form.

How often can I apply?

Students may only apply for and receive emergency funding once per semester. 

How much will I receive?

The College received a limited amount of funds. We cannot guarantee that all applications submitted will be eligible for funding. Grant amounts will be determined based on the number of applications received and the specific needs presented in the application. Generally, emergency grants will not exceed $250.

How do I receive the money?

Emergency grants will be processed through your Montco student account and, if you are enrolled in direct deposit, the funds will be deposited into the bank account on file. If you do not have direct deposit set up with the College, you will receive a refund check in the mail.

What other resources are available to help with personal finance and planning for financial emergencies?

PA Benefits Center

Many community college students are eligible for public benefits that can help pay for food, healthcare, childcare and more. The College has teamed up with national nonprofit, Benefits Data Trust, to support you in applying for public benefits. A Benefits Center specialists can walk you through the screening and application process for up to 14 benefits in one phone call.

Financial Coaching with Financial Avenue

To help with personal finances, Montco is committed to providing our students with the opportunity for free financial coaching. Our partnership with Inceptia gives you access to Financial Avenue, a free online financial education program with topics ranging from budgeting and saving to student loan repayment to planning for life events such as buying a home.

  • Visit the Financial Avenue website
  • Enter your Montco email address
  • Select if you are a "new user" or you "already have an Inceptia log-in" and enter the required information based on your selection
  • Click "Enroll in Course"
  • Click "Go to the Course" to view and complete the avaiable financial educaiton modules
